Thick 5G services refer to high-capacity, ultra-reliable, and low-latency 5G network solutions designed for data-intensive applications, enterprise-level operations, and advanced connectivity use cases. These services leverage massive MIMO, mmWave spectrum, edge computing, and network slicing to enable:
β
Ultra-fast data speeds (10 Gbps+)
β
High-density connectivity (IoT, smart cities)
β
Low latency (critical for AI, AR/VR, and autonomous tech)
β
Enhanced mobile broadband (eMBB) for seamless streaming, gaming, and virtual experiences

The 5G services market is highly competitive, with telecom giants, cloud service providers, and AI-driven networking companies leading innovation.
-
Telecom Operators: Verizon, AT&T, T-Mobile, China Mobile, Vodafone
-
Cloud & AI Companies: AWS, Microsoft Azure, Google Cloud (5G edge solutions)
-
Network Equipment Providers: Nokia, Ericsson, Huawei, Samsung
-
Private 5G & Enterprise Solutions: Cisco, Qualcomm, Intel
-
Verizon β Ultra Wideband 5G, enterprise 5G solutions
-
AT&T β Industrial & IoT 5G networks
-
T-Mobile β Consumer and nationwide 5G expansion
-
China Mobile β Largest 5G rollout in the world
-
Nokia & Ericsson β Key players in 5G infrastructure
-
Qualcomm & Intel β 5G chipsets and AI-driven connectivity
